The global Blood Collection Monitors market size was valued at approximately USD 750 million in 2025 and is projected to reach USD 1,500 million by 2035, growing at a CAGR of 7.2% during the forecast period. Blood Collection Monitors are medical devices designed to monitor and manage blood extraction procedures, ensuring optimal safety and efficiency. These devices are integral to clinical laboratories, hospitals, blood banks, and diagnostic centers, playing a crucial role in patient care and diagnostic accuracy. Key stakeholders include manufacturers, healthcare providers, regulatory bodies, and end-users committed to enhancing clinical outcomes.

Blood collection monitoring has evolved significantly over the years, transitioning from manual processes to sophisticated technology-driven systems. This transformation is crucial for reducing blood wastage, enhancing patient safety, and meeting regulatory standards. The market represents an amalgamation of healthcare and technological advancement, ensuring precise operation in various clinical settings.
By Product Type: The market is segmented by product type to address diverse clinical requirements and operational needs, with manual and automated monitors showing varying levels of adoption based on healthcare infrastructure. Automated blood collection monitors contribute more substantially due to their integration with advanced technologies, improving efficiency in high-volume health setups.
By Application: Application-based segmentation reflects distinct end-use requirements and healthcare priorities. Diagnostics application holds a larger market share due to the high demand for timely and accurate results, which is critical in medical evaluations and interventions.
By End User: Segmentation by end users such as hospitals and clinics provides insights into differing purchasing behaviors and usage patterns, with hospitals becoming the largest segment due to pervasive diagnostic and therapeutic demands.

During the historical period, the Blood Collection Monitors market observed a steady growth drive, predominantly due to technological integration and rising awareness among healthcare providers regarding efficient blood collection techniques. Currently, the market is in a robust growth phase, propelled by increasing investments in healthcare infrastructure and technological advancements. The future outlook of the market suggests a continuous trajectory of innovation with burgeoning demand from emerging economies, reflecting a universal uptick in healthcare service efficiency and patient-oriented technology adoption.
Key market drivers include a surge in chronic ailments requiring regular monitoring, thus enhancing blood collection demand. Investment trends show significant CAPEX towards adopting state-of-the-art automated systems designed for accuracy and ease of use. Challenges such as high operational costs, supply chain complexities, and stringent regulatory frameworks continue to exist, pressuring market participants to innovate and optimize cost structures.
The leading segment by product type is automated blood collection monitors, accounting for the largest market share due to advanced technological integration. These devices ensure precision and speed, crucial in high-demand settings like hospitals. The fastest-growing segment is projected to be automated blood collection monitors as technological proliferation continues to dominate industry shifts. Emerging segments include those incorporating AI and machine learning for advanced diagnostics and monitoring capabilities, paving the way for future market opportunities and investment allure.
